How did reptiles survive the Ice Age?
Reptiles have been around for millions of years, but they're cold-blooded and don't do well in cold temperatures, which is why you find them commonly in Africa and Australia, but less commonly in Canada and Norway! So, my question is how did they manage to survive throughout the Ice Age? Obviously they did, because we still have snakes, crocodiles and lizards all still around.
The ice age didn't mean the whole globe froze over - it just got colder. The equator of the earth, and even south of, say, what is now texas, was still pretty warm.
